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from St Leonards Warrior Square to Hampton Court start from as little as £10.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from St Leonards Warrior Square to Hampton Court start from £47.40 one way, or £47.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from St Leonards Warrior Square to Hampton Court are available for £38.10 one way, or £76.20 return

Facilities and Amenities

St Leonards Warrior Square Train Station provides passengers with a comprehensive range of facilities. Visitors can take advantage of a ticket office that opens early in the morning on weekdays and slightly later on weekends, ensuring you're always prepared for spur-of-the-moment travel. For your convenience, ticket machines are also available, with accessible machines located on platform 1 for easy ticket collection.

Accessibility is a priority here. While the station offers limited step-free access, efforts are made to assist those with mobility challenges. Information and help points are stationed here for your support, alongside departure screens and announcements to keep you updated. Although there are no waiting rooms available, seating spaces are provided where you can relax before boarding. While the station does not currently offer Wi-Fi or public shops, there's a café and Selecta vending machines ready to fuel your journey.

Onward Travel Connections

The station is well-connected, offering bus services for those who need to travel further afield. Bus stops for destinations such as Hastings and Battle can be found near the Queen Victoria statue on Grand Parade. Station Facilities & Amenities

At Hampton Court Train Station, the focus is on ensuring passenger convenience and accessibility. The station is equipped with a staffed ticket office with extensive opening hours from 06:30 to 18:30 during weekdays, 08:00 to 19:00 on Saturdays, and 09:00 to 17:40 on Sundays. For added convenience, there are ticket machines available, allowing passengers to swiftly collect tickets bought online.

Boasting full step-free access, the station caters to passengers with mobility impairments, offering wheelchair availability and accessible toilets. While there is no staffed help available, customer help points and guards on the train provide assistance as needed. Additionally, public CCTV and seating areas are accessible throughout the station premises.

For cyclists, Hampton Court provides ample bicycle storage facilities with 178 spaces on Platform 3, equipped with sheltered, CCTV-monitored racks. Although there are no cycle hire facilities at the station, its superb connectivity makes it an ideal spot for a green commute.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Hampton Court's transport connectivity is robust, underpinned by its strategic location off Hampton Court Way (A309), making it easily accessible for rail replacement services. Bus services are well-integrated, with information readily available in a downloadable format for planning onward journeys. For those preferring to drive, the station offers a large car park with 204 spaces and dedicated spots for blue badge holders, although hiring a car directly at the station is not an option.
